KENTUCKY CREAM CANDY (from Southern Living)
4 cups sugar
1 cup water
1/8 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 cup whipping cream
Combine sugar, water, soda, and salt in a large Dutch oven" cook over medium heat, stirring constantly until sugar dissolves. Cover and continue to cook 2-3 min to wash down sugar from sides. Uncover and cook without stirring until mixture reaches soft ball stage (234^)
Gradually add whipping cream, without stirring. Continue cooking over medium heat until mix. reaches hard ball stage (260^).
Remove from heat; pour mixture into a well-buttered 15x10x1 inch jellyroll pan. Allow mixture to cool slightly.
Work mixture into a mound, using a buttered spatula or candy scraper. Pick up mound with buttered hands; pull, fold, and twist until candy is opaque and begins to stiffen. Divide candy in half, and pull each half into a rope, 1/2 inch in diameter. Twist ropes together, and cut into 1-inch pieces. Wrap each piece in waxed paper. Yield: about 6 dozen.
